2.3
System Configurations and Available Function*
The
AJ71C24
is
a link module to connect an external device (such as a
computer) and a
PC CPU.
The system can consist
of
a
single external device
and from
1
to
32 PC CPU
stations
(1
:
1
to
32
ratio system) or two external
devices and from
1
to
32 PC CPU
stations
(2
:
1
to
32
ratio system). The
connection may be made
in
two ways: using the
RS-232C
port or the
RS-422
port.

POINTS
I
(1)
Use of the
RS-232C
and the
RS-422
interfaces differs
in
that the
RS-422
is used to connect long distances (up
to
500
m
(1640.5
ft))
and the
RS-232C
is used to connect short distances (a maximum of
15
m
(49.2
ft)).
(2) To
have the
RS-232C
communicate over a distance greater than
15
m
(49.2
ft),
use a modem
or
RS-232C/RS-422
converter between the
external device and the
AJ71 C24.
